# Multi-File Content Pages One of FolderWeb's most powerful features is the ability to compose a single page from multiple content files. This gives you flexibility in how you organize and author your content. ## How It Works When a folder contains **no subdirectories**, FolderWeb treats it as a **page-type folder**. All `.md`, `.html`, and `.php` files in that folder are rendered in **alphanumerical order**. This means you can: - Break long content into manageable sections - Mix file formats freely (Markdown, HTML, PHP) - Reorder sections by renaming files - Include dynamic PHP content alongside static content
